Birchgrove Station provides the essentials for a hassle-free start to your journey. It doesn't have a traditional ticket office, but ticket machines are conveniently available for collecting pre-purchased tickets. These machines only accept card payments, ensuring a quick and cash-free transaction. For those who need additional assistance, an induction loop facility is in place, alongside support available via an external helpline. While there is no CCTV or on-site staff, the station is equipped with departure and arrival screens to keep travelers informed.
Accessibility at the station is categorized as B1, meaning there is step-free access from Waun y Groes Avenue. However, there are no waiting rooms or first-class lounges, which makes the station a more practical, rather than leisurely, stop. Seating is available for those who may need to rest. While there are no accessible facilities such as toilets or parking, ramps for train access are provisioned ensuring ease for those with mobility devices.
Birchgrove offers multiple connections for onward travel, linking you effortlessly with the bustling hubs around the area. If you're thinking about continuing your journey via public transport, local bus services can be found on Caerphilly Road, just a stone’s throw from the station. Notably, this main road is the gateway for catching the rail replacement bus service should you experience any disruptions.
Additionally, bicycle hire options are available, although there’s no provision for bicycle storage at the station itself. This could be a great chance to enjoy the scenic routes for short, green-friendly trips if you’re exploring more locally.

Clacton-on-Sea station makes ticketing a breeze with both a ticket office and machines available for purchase and collection — accessible ticket machines ensure all passengers can buy their tickets smoothly. Smart travelers can also benefit from the smartcard services offered at this station. With an induction loop available, customer support is always within reach. Staff assistance is available through help points and the ticket office during regular hours from Monday to Sunday, alongside customer information screens and announcements to keep everyone informed.
The station offers step-free access throughout the entire premises, making it a welcoming place for all visitors. There are accessible toilets, baby-changing facilities, and a range of refreshment facilities, including The Station Bar and the 'Steam' kiosk, as well as vending machines. Public Wi-Fi is also available, keeping you connected while on the move. Cyclists will find ample cycle storage with 108 spaces for bikes around the station.
Getting around from Clacton-on-Sea station is simple with comprehensive transport links. Rail replacement buses service the station forecourt, ensuring smooth transitions when required. Local buses stop outside the station, and the location is part of the PlusBus scheme, offering affordable travel options in the area. While taxis and car hire are standard, note that accessible taxis are not available directly here. For those driving to the station, parking is provided by National Car Parks Ltd, offering 49 spaces, including four designated accessible spots.
